Three Nepalis die in Portugal



KATHMANDU: Three Nepalis have been killed in Portugal in eight days. Toran Bahadur Thapa, 47, from Pokhara was found dead in his apartment in Portugal.

According to Thapa’s family sources, he died due to cardiac arrest.

He was living with his family in Portugal and had been suffering from diabetes and hypertension.

Likewise, Nabin Kumar Pathak, 41, of Nuwakot died on December 8. Similarly, a 29-year-old man from Pokhara died in Portugal last Tuesday.

He was found dead in his room.
